Differentiation of three scuticociliatosis causing species in olive flounder (Paralichthys olivaceus) by multiplex PCR

Abstract
The definitive identification of ciliate species by morphological characteristics relies on time-consuming and laborious staining techniques. Therefore, in this study, we discriminated 3 scuticociliatosis causing species - Pseudocohnilembus persalinus, Uronema marinum and Philasterides dicentrarchi - in cultured olive flounder by multiplex PCR. The multiplex PCR based on the species-specific amplification of small subunit ribosomal RNA (SS rRNA) gene sequence enabled us to distinguish the 3 scuticociliate species in a simple and rapid manner, even in the sample containing the three species simultaneously. These data suggest that the multiplex PCR strategy would make it possible to avoid the cumbersome and time-consuming procedures of morphological analysis for the definitive identification of scuticociliates.
